What is medical oncology?

Medical oncology is a critical component in modern cancer care. Oncologists drive care plan development—managing therapies as well as coordinating care among other cancer specialists who focus on prevention, treatment and clinical trials.

What is hematology?

Hematologists are specifically trained in the diagnosis and treatment of blood disorders. This includes conditions affecting red and white blood cells, platelets, lymph nodes, bone marrow, blood vessels, and the spleen.
